Schroder Investment Management Group cut its position in shares of Lumentum Holdings Inc. (NASDAQ:LITE - Free Report) by 36.8% in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 1,033,344 shares of the technology company's stock after selling 602,064 shares during the quarter. Schroder Investment Management Group owned 1.50% of Lumentum worth $86,636,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.
Other hedge funds and other institutional investors also recently made changes to their positions in the company. Norges Bank purchased a new stake in shares of Lumentum in the 4th quarter valued at approximately $68,962,000. Atreides Management LP raised its stake in Lumentum by 28.5% during the 3rd quarter. Atreides Management LP now owns 1,691,017 shares of the technology company's stock valued at $107,177,000 after purchasing an additional 375,389 shares during the period. Point72 Hong Kong Ltd purchased a new stake in shares of Lumentum in the third quarter valued at $17,981,000. Arrowstreet Capital Limited Partnership acquired a new stake in shares of Lumentum in the fourth quarter worth $15,945,000. Finally, Proficio Capital Partners LLC purchased a new position in shares of Lumentum during the fourth quarter valued at $13,421,000. 94.05% of the stock is currently owned by institutional investors and hedge funds.
Lumentum Stock Performance
Shares of LITE stock traded down $3.89 during trading on Friday, reaching $49.56. The company had a trading volume of 5,873,362 shares, compared to its average volume of 1,782,949. The firm's 50 day simple moving average is $71.46 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$76.13. Lumentum Holdings Inc. has a one year low of $38.29 and a one year high of $104.00.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.94, a current ratio of 4.76 and a quick ratio of 3.60. The company has a market capitalization of $3.43 billion, a PE ratio of -6.44 and a beta of 1.14.
Lumentum (NASDAQ:LITE -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, February 13th. The technology company reported ($0.14) EPS for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$0.27 by ($0.41). Lumentum had a negative net margin of 36.98% and a negative return on equity of 7.25%. Sell-side analysts forecast that Lumentum Holdings Inc. will post 0.03 earnings per share for the current year.

Lumentum Holdings Inc manufactures and sells optical and photonic products in the Americas, the Asia-Pacific,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. The company operates through two segments: Optical Communications (OpComms) and Commercial Lasers (Lasers). The OpComms segment offers components, modules, and subsystems that enable the transmission and transport of video, audio, and data over high-capacity fiber optic cables.
